This is why I do not trust the forecasters. They are only 80%-90% accurate. I need 100% accuracy to keep my plants alive. If the predicted temperature is below 39 and the dew point is higher than the temp, I assume frost will happen (unless there is a strong breeze all night).  I end up protecting my plants several times a year when I didn't need to, but it saves them on the one night every year that they missed the forecast on.

The wind is my friend during a frost but at 32°, it's my adversary. So when I want it I generally don't get it but when I do get it it's too much. Ambient Air Temperature predictions I take the most pessimistic and anything below 37 I just go ahead and do the drill assuming there will be frost. The change in humidity and dew point from late night to early morning changes hourly and their prediction is hopefully in the a.m. close to Sunrise. I definitely prefer them to be pessimistic and not optimistic because you cannot undo the damage. And you will have all summer to curse yourself but with pessimistic prediction you get some exercise maybe lose a little sleep. But we all know if we do nothing we're not going to sleep anyways just tossed and turn. Some of these things have to be done in advance even if you have your own weather station by the time you realize what the dew point is other than turning on your irrigation you're behind the curve.
